I disassemble a fluorescent strip light for bathroom. With a couple of connectors and cable, I adapted it to my requirements.

You can see the control circuit in the top left of the next picture.

Ventilation holes were made, although the fluorescent generates little heat.

The installed fluorescent is 12W. With 8W would have been enough, but that type tend to be shorter.

The artwork is printed on "back light" paper, and is based on Project MAME by Rasmus Kønig.

The artwok is installed between two pieces of methacrylate, as a sandwich. The fluorescent proves to be too bright, so I add a white adhesive on the back methacrylate piece, to decrease and diffuse the light.
